If you contact Home Office they will hook you up with a director who lives in your area. I have gotten referrals from people as far as 45 minutes or so from my home. They rotate the referrals through the directors to be fair. There may be others who live closer to you on their list but they refer to the next one in line. There are also consultants who are not directors that may live closer too but referrals are only given to directors and above.
